Abstract

The utility model discloses an automatic early warning device for greenhouse environment, which relates to the technical field of environment monitoring and comprises a bottom plate, the top of the bottom plate is fixedly connected with a protective shell, the top of the protective shell is in contact connection with a monitoring box, and the right side of the inner bottom wall of the monitoring box is fixedly provided with a monitor. A storage battery is fixedly installed on the right side of the inner bottom wall of the monitoring box, alarms are fixedly installed on the front side and the rear side of the top of the monitoring box, a filtering mechanism is arranged on the monitoring box, an adjusting mechanism is arranged on the top of the bottom plate, and the filtering mechanism comprises a first motor fixedly installed in the middle of the front face of the monitoring box. According to the automatic early warning device for the greenhouse environment, the effect of filtering dust in air is achieved, so that the dust in the air is prevented from entering the monitoring box to affect normal work of the monitor, the detection precision of the monitor is further improved, meanwhile, the filter plate is convenient to clean, and the filtering effect of the filter plate is guaranteed.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to environmental monitoring technical field, especially a kind of greenhouse environment automatic early warning device. BACKGROUND

[0002] Greenhouse environment automatic early warning device is a device for monitoring and early warning greenhouse environment parameter anomaly, which can help users to find problems in time and take measures to protect the growth and production of greenhouse crops.

[0003] Chinese patent document CN216383254U discloses an environmental automatic monitoring and early warning device, which comprises a support rod and a monitor. The bottom end of the support rod is connected with a grounding pad, which is attached to the ground. The top end of the support rod is connected with a mounting seat, in which the monitor is installed. The front end face of the mounting seat is also provided with an audible and visual alarm. The outer wall of the support rod is provided with a reinforcing sleeve. The lower surface of the reinforcing sleeve is connected with three groups of telescopic struts. The bottom ends of the three groups of telescopic struts are attached to the ground, and they are arranged in a reinforcing sleeve annular array. This design can reinforce the connection of the environmental monitoring and early warning device from multiple directions, prevent the device from toppling over in strong wind weather, and improve the stability of use. Moreover, the environmental automatic monitoring and early warning device is easy to disassemble, which facilitates subsequent separate transportation and carrying, and has good practicality.

[0004] The existing technology has the following problems:

[0005] The environmental monitoring and early warning device is directly exposed to the air during use, which causes a large amount of dust to adhere to the surface of the device after a certain period of use, affecting the subsequent detection data. INVENTION CONTENTS

D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0027] In order to make the technical means, creation features, reach the purpose and the efficacy of the utility model easy to understand, the following is further elaborated the utility model in combination with specific implementation.

[0028] For example, Figures 1-6As shown, a kind of greenhouse environment automatic early warning device, including bottom plate 1, the top of bottom plate 1 is fixedly connected with protective shell 2, the top of protective shell 2 is contact connection with monitoring box 3, the right side of the inner bottom wall of monitoring box 3 is fixedly installed with monitor 4, the right side of the inner bottom wall of monitoring box 3 is fixedly installed with battery 5, the front and rear sides of the top of monitoring box 3 are all fixedly installed with alarm 6, monitoring box 3 is provided with filter mechanism 7, the top of bottom plate 1 is provided with adjusting mechanism 8;

[0029] Filter mechanism 7 includes the first motor 71 fixedly installed in the front middle part of monitoring box 3, the output shaft of first motor 71 is fixedly connected with first bevel gear 72, the left side of the inner bottom wall of monitoring box 3 is fixedly connected with support plate 73;

[0030] Adjusting mechanism 8 includes two connecting plates 81 fixedly connected with the top of bottom plate 1, the left side of left connecting plate 81 is fixedly installed with second motor 82, the output shaft of second motor 82 is fixedly connected with worm 83.

[0031] It needs to be explained that by setting monitor 4, it is convenient to monitor the environmental parameters such as temperature and humidity in air, if environmental parameter appears abnormally, alarm 6 issues warning sound to remind staff, by setting battery 5, it is convenient to power monitor 4.

[0032] As shown, Figures 1-3 The middle part of support plate 73 is rotatably connected with rotary rod 74, the left side of rotary rod 74 is fixedly connected with fan 75, the right side of rotary rod 74 is fixedly connected with second bevel gear 76, the outside of first bevel gear 72 is engaged with the outside of second bevel gear 76, the left and right sides of monitoring box 3 are all fixedly connected with filter plate 77, and rotary rod 74 is provided with cleaning assembly 78.

[0033] It needs to be explained that starting first motor 71, the output shaft of first motor 71 drives first bevel gear 72 to rotate, first bevel gear 72 drives second bevel gear 76 to rotate, second bevel gear 76 drives rotary rod 74 to rotate, rotary rod 74 drives fan 75 to rotate, so that it is convenient to suck the air in greenhouse, improve the working efficiency of monitoring and early warning device, by setting filter plate 77, dust in air is filtered, avoid dust in air to enter the inside of monitoring box and influence the normal work of monitor 4, to increase the detection accuracy of monitor 4.

[0034] As shown, Figures 1-3As shown, the cleaning assembly 78 comprises a first pulley 781 fixedly connected to the outer right side of the rotating rod 74, and positioning plates 782 fixedly connected to the top of the monitoring box 3 on both sides, and movable rods 783 rotatably connected to the interiors of the two positioning plates 782, and a second pulley 784 fixedly connected to the outer left side of the movable rod 783, and the outer side of the first pulley 781 and the outer side of the second pulley 784 are drivingly connected through a belt 785, and cleaning plates 786 are fixedly connected to the left and right sides of the movable rod 783, and a cover 787 is fixedly connected to the top of the monitoring box 3.

[0035] It should be noted that the rotating rod 74 simultaneously drives the first pulley 781 to rotate, the first pulley 781 drives the second pulley 784 to rotate through the belt 785, the second pulley 784 drives the movable rod 783 to rotate, and the movable rod 783 drives the two cleaning plates 786 to rotate, so that the dust adhered to the filter plates 77 is scraped off, thereby ensuring the filtering effect of the filter plates 77.

[0036] As shown in Figures 1-3 The top of the monitoring box 3 is provided with a rectangular through hole, and the size of the rectangular through hole is greater than the size of the belt 785.

[0037] It should be noted that the rectangular through hole is arranged to ensure the normal transmission of the belt 785 and the normal operation of the monitoring and early warning device.

[0038] As shown in Figures 1-3 The two cleaning plates 786 are rotatably connected to the opposite sides of the two filter plates 77.

[0039] It should be noted that the cleaning plates 786 are arranged to facilitate the scraping off of the dust adhered to the filter plates 77 when the cleaning plates 786 rotate.

[0040] As shown in Figures 4-6 The top side of the bottom plate 1 is rotatably connected to a threaded rod 84, the outer top side of the threaded rod 84 is screw-connected to a support column 85, the outer bottom side of the threaded rod 84 is fixedly connected to a worm gear 86, the outer side of the worm gear 83 is engaged with the outer side of the worm gear 86, the front and rear sides of the top of the bottom plate 1 are rotatably connected to sleeves 87, the inner bottom walls of the two sleeves 87 are fixedly connected to support springs 88, and the top sides of the front and rear sides of the support column 85 are rotatably connected to support rods 89.

[0041] It should be noted that the second motor 82 is started, the second motor 82 drives the worm gear 83 to rotate, the worm gear 83 drives the worm gear 86 to rotate, the worm gear 86 drives the threaded rod 84 to rotate, the threaded rod 84 drives the support column 85 to move upward, and the support column 85 drives the monitoring box 3 to move upward, thereby adjusting the height of the monitoring box 3, facilitating the monitoring of different heights of the greenhouse, and improving the versatility of the monitoring and early warning device.

[0042] As shown in Figures 4-6As shown, the top of the support column 85 is fixedly connected with the bottom of the monitoring box 3, the top of the support spring 88 is fixedly connected with the bottom of the support rod 89, and the outer side of the support rod 89 is slidably connected with the inner wall of the sleeve 87.

[0043] It should be noted that the support rod 89 moves upward in the interior of the sleeve 87, and the support spring 88 is stretched to support the support rod 89, thereby increasing the stability of the movement of the support column 85, and further increasing the stability of the height adjustment of the monitoring box 3.

[0044] The working principle of the utility model is: when using, the monitoring and early warning device is placed in the place that needs, the first motor 71 is started, the output shaft of the first motor 71 drives the first bevel gear 72 to rotate, the first bevel gear 72 drives the second bevel gear 76 to rotate, the second bevel gear 76 drives the rotary rod 74 to rotate, the rotary rod 74 drives the fan 75 to rotate, thereby conveniently sucking the air in the greenhouse, improve the working efficiency of monitoring and early warning device, through setting filter plate 77, the dust in the air is filtered, avoid the dust in the air to enter the interior of monitoring box and influence the normal work of monitor 4, thereby increase the detection accuracy of monitor 4, rotary rod 74 simultaneously drives the first pulley 781 to rotate, the first pulley 781 drives the second pulley 784 to rotate through the belt 785, the second pulley 784 drives the movable rod 783 to rotate, the movable rod 783 drives two cleaning plates 786 to rotate, thereby scraping the dust sticking on filter plate 77, guarantee the filtering effect of filter plate 77, through setting adjusting mechanism 8, the second motor 82 is started, the second motor 82 drives the worm 83 to rotate, the worm 83 drives the worm wheel 86 to rotate, the worm wheel 86 drives the threaded rod 84 to rotate, the threaded rod 84 drives the support column 85 to move upward, the support column 85 drives the monitoring box 3 to move upward, thereby adjusting the height of monitoring box 3, conveniently monitoring the different height of greenhouse, improve the versatility of monitoring and early warning device, simultaneously support rod 89 moves upward in the interior of sleeve 87, support spring 88 is stretched to support support rod 89, thereby increasing the stability of the movement of support column 85, and further increasing the stability of the height adjustment of the monitoring box 3.
